Malindi Mosque
The Malindi Mosque is one of the oldest and most architecturally unique mosques in Stone Town, Zanzibar. Located in the Malindi quarter near the port, its origins are believed to date back to the 15th century, though the current structure was primarily developed in the 18th and 19th centuries. The mosque's most striking feature is its unusual conical minaret set upon a square base, a design rarity in Zanzibar, where most mosques either lack minarets or feature square ones. Built by the Sunni community, the building represents the understated and functional style of early Swahili Islamic architecture. Unlike the ornate palaces of the Omani Sultans, the Malindi Mosque focuses on simplicity and spiritual utility. It remains an active place of worship today, standing as a significant testament to the long-standing Islamic traditions and the maritime history of the island's coastal communities.

Best time to visit & climate
The most pleasant time to visit is Jun–Aug.
|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g °C | 27 | 27 | 27 | 27 | 25 | 24 | 24 | 24 | 25 | 26 | 27 | 27 |
| Rain mm | 118 | 89 | 163 | 279 | 171 | 28 | 21 | 27 | 41 | 111 | 164 | 141 |
